For 6 years we have been teaching our seven week summer tennis camps at Creekside High Tennis courts because our kids outgrew the 4 courts at Mills Field tennis club. We have 8 tennis courts we can fill up for kids ages 4-18 years old, all levels of tennis play. For 6 years we have celebrated "Wimbledon Week" in which we all dress in white, commemorate with a professional group photo of Academy tennis players and PTR Tennis Pro's. We also have a tradition of a week long tournament play with a format just as you would have in Wimbledon and eat delicious Strawberries, which is a Wimbledon staple food. The kids learn about all the Grand Slam tournaments of the year and we teach nutrition, strategy and mental health for tournament play.

Our 8 & Under red ball class has been full every week! We can fit 8 kids on one adult size court in which we work on forehand & backhand groundstrokes on Mondays, Volleys and Overheads on Tuesdays and Underhand and Overhead serves on Thursdays. Of course, every day we play tons of game in which the kids are learning technique through games. They LOVE tennis!!

Weather: We will always keep you up to date if weather is an issue so you can check our website at www.saintjohnstennis.com 30 minutes before your clinic if we have weather delays or cancellations. You can also sign up for Twitter to get push notifications on our website if you choose to use it.
We only cancel if the courts are wet or it's actively raining. Hard courts are slippery when wet and they ruin our balls. IF we choose to cancel within the week because of the weather we have reserved WEDNESDAYS to be our designated make up day at your classes regularly scheduled time.
